Weather Photographer of the Year announced

Rudolf Sulgan’s image, Blizzard, showing Brooklyn Bridge in New York, was announced the winner of the Royal Meteorological Society’s Weather Photographer of the Year 2020, in association with AccuWeather. 2020 New Generation Award winners announced

Scotiabank and the National Gallery of Canada announced the winners of the third annual New Generation Photography Award, which recognizes the best of young Canadians working in lens-based art and aims to elevate their careers. Zebrafish pic wins 46th annual Nikon Small World Photo Microscopy Competition

Nikon Instruments Inc. announced the winners of the forty-sixth annual Nikon Small World Photomicrography Competition. Daniel Castranova, assisted by Bakary Samasa while working in the lab of Dr. Brant Weinstein at the National Institutes of Health, took the top prize for his artfully rendered and technically immaculate photo of a juvenile zebrafish.
